Nociception—the ability to feel pain—is essential for an organism’s survival and overall well-being. Noxious stimuli such as piercing pain from a sharp object, heat from an open flame, or contact with corrosive chemicals are first detected by sensory receptors, called nociceptors, located on nerve endings. Nociceptors express ion channels that convert noxious stimuli into electrical signals. When these signals reach the brain via sensory neurons, they are perceived as pain.

Core Competencies in Integrative Pain Care for Entry-Level Primary Care Physicians.

Heather Tick1, Sheila W Chauvin2, Michael Brown3,4

  • 1Department of Family Medicine, Anesthesiology & Pain Medicine, University of Washington School of Medicine, Seattle, WA, USA.

Pain Medicine (Malden, Mass.)
|July 17, 2015
PubMed
Summary

Core competencies for primary care physicians in integrative pain care (IPC) were developed using ACGME domains. These competencies emphasize interprofessional skills and attitudes for patient-centered, collaborative pain management.

Area of Science:

  • Medical Education
  • Pain Management
  • Integrative Health

Background:

  • Growing need for coordinated pain care services.
  • Existing gaps in primary care physician training for integrative pain management.
  • Recommendations for interprofessional collaboration in pain medicine.

Purpose of the Study:

  • To develop core competencies for graduating primary care physicians in integrative pain care (IPC).
  • To align these competencies with Accreditation Council for Graduate Medical Education (ACGME) domains.
  • To inform residency training curricula for improved pain management.

Main Methods:

  • Formation of an interprofessional task force with diverse expertise.
  • A 1.5-day in-person meeting followed by surveys and vetting processes.
  • Consensus-building among diverse interprofessional groups to finalize competencies.

Main Results:

  • Development of core competencies focusing on interprofessional knowledge, skills, and attitudes (KSAs).
  • Competencies align with recommendations for integrated, coordinated pain care services.
  • Physician competencies are compatible with ACGME domains and reflect interdisciplinary contributions.

Conclusions:

  • Core competencies provide a framework for curriculum development in integrative pain care.
  • Learning experiences should promote interprofessional, patient-centered, and evidence-based care.
  • Graduating physicians will be better equipped to provide safe and effective pain treatments using integrative approaches.
